As part of our ongoing growth, we’re now looking to appoint a dedicated and highly skilled Fire Safety Manager. This is a critical post responsible for delivering the company’s Fire Safety contract for Blackpool Teaching Hospitals, ensuring compliance across their wide and complex healthcare estate.

A pivotal role in safety and assurance

You will act as the Appointed Person (AP) for fire safety, taking responsibility for shaping and delivering an effective fire safety management strategy across both acute and community-based sites. From conducting audits and risk assessments to leading on fire safety training and reporting performance, this is a wide ranging role with serious impact.

You’ll be working closely with our clients - including clinical teams and senior Trust leaders - to ensure all fire safety legislation is met, while championing a proactive and positive safety culture throughout the organisation.

This is a position for someone who not only understands compliance but thrives on leading change and driving excellence across a critical operational area.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Act as the senior fire safety specialist and key advisor to Atlas and our clients.
  • Lead the development and implementation of fire safety policies, risk management strategies, and audit programmes.
  • Provide expert guidance and training on compliance with the Regulatory Reform (Fire Safety) Order, HTM 05, and all other relevant legislation.
  • Conduct fire risk assessments, manage incident investigations, and maintain statutory documentation.
  • Liaise directly with the Trust, Fire and Rescue Services, and other regulatory bodies.
  • Prepare formal reports and performance updates for Client Boards and Assurance Committees.
  • Oversee and mentor fire safety team members, and manage external fire safety contractors.
  • Ensure seamless communication and partnership working between Atlas and the Trust on all matters of compliance and fire risk mitigation.

What you’ll bring:

  • A qualification at HNC/HND level or equivalent in a relevant discipline, and the NEBOSH Fire Safety Certificate (or equivalent).
  • Membership of a recognised fire safety body (e.g. Institute of Fire Engineers).
  • Extensive experience in fire safety management, including conducting fire risk assessments and training delivery.
  • In-depth understanding of fire-related legislation and guidance.
  • Strong communication skills, with the confidence to engage across all levels - from fire wardens to Trust executives.
  • A collaborative mindset and a passion for delivering services that keep people safe.
